I don't intend to try to force you into anything, but the Mission Editor is extremely simple to use for something like setting up free flight. I don't even use instant actions because the ME is simpler and more powerful. Just select the map after opening the ME, then on the left side you will see an airplane icon. Click it and then click on the map to place a plane. On the right side of the screen there will then be a popup to select plane type, etc. Set this as you want, planes with yellow names are flyable, but make sure to set the skill setting to "Player" so you can fly it. Once this is done click the fly button (green check) on the left menu.
